Understanding Harop Drones
The world of unmanned aerial vehicles (UAVs) is rapidly evolving, and one name that has been making headlines is Harop drones. These loitering munitions are known for their precision and efficiency in various operations. The question on many minds is, which country is behind this innovative technology?
The answer lies in Israel, a nation renowned for its cutting-edge advancements in military technology. Israel Aerospace Industries (IAI) is the mastermind behind the development of Harop drones. The Harop, often categorized under loitering munition, is a testament to Israel’s expertise in designing UAVs that can autonomously detect and destroy targets.
Characteristics of Harop Drones
Harop drones have several unique features that set them apart in the realm of UAV technology. Unlike traditional drones, the Harop can hover over targets for extended periods, giving tactical teams on the ground the edge of patience and precision. This drone is equipped with sophisticated electro-optical sensors that enable it to identify and eliminate targets with unrivaled accuracy. Not only does the Harop serve as an intelligence tool, but it also doubles as an offensive weapon due to its ability to self-destruct upon target acquisition.
